Egg Roll Soup Recipe

  • Total Time: 27 minutes
  • Yield: 4 1x

Description

Comforting Korean-inspired egg roll soup delivers a delightful twist on classic takeout flavors. Packed with savory ground pork, crisp vegetables, and rich broth, you’ll savor each spoonful of this hearty culinary adventure.


Ingredients

Scale

Protein:

  • 1 pound lean ground beef

Vegetables:

  • 1 medium white onion, peeled and diced
  • 2 medium carrots, peeled and diced
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 small green cabbage, chopped into bite-sized pieces

Liquid and Seasonings:

  • 6 to 8 cups chicken or vegetable stock
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 2 teaspoons ground ginger
  • 1 teaspoon toasted sesame oil

Garnish:

  • Toasted sesame seeds
  • Thinly sliced green onions
  • Homemade fried egg roll wrappers
  • Store-bought wonton strips

Instructions

  1. Brown the ground beef in a large stockpot over medium heat. Cook for 5-6 minutes, stirring occasionally until the meat turns a rich brown color. Remove the cooked beef with a slotted spoon and set aside on a plate.
  2. Drizzle olive oil in the same pot and sauté diced onions for 5 minutes until they become soft and slightly caramelized. Add minced garlic and carrots, cooking for an additional 2 minutes to release their aromatic flavors.
  3. Incorporate chopped cabbage, ground ginger, and stock into the vegetable mixture. Stir thoroughly to distribute ingredients evenly. Return the cooked ground beef to the pot.
  4. Bring the soup to a gentle simmer over medium heat, then reduce temperature to medium-low. Cover and let it simmer for 15 minutes, allowing vegetables to become tender without losing their texture.
  5. Finish the soup by stirring in sesame oil. Taste and adjust seasoning with salt and pepper according to preference.
  6. Serve hot in individual bowls, garnishing with toasted sesame seeds, thinly sliced green onions, or crispy wonton strips for added crunch and visual appeal.

Notes

  • Meat Selection Choose lean ground beef to reduce excess fat and create a cleaner, lighter soup base.
  • Cabbage Cutting Slice cabbage into uniform, thin strips to ensure even cooking and consistent texture throughout the soup.
  • Vegetable Variations Swap ground beef with ground turkey or plant-based protein for a lighter, diet-friendly alternative that maintains the egg roll flavor profile.
  • Seasoning Strategy Start with small amounts of sesame oil and gradually increase to control the intense flavor, preventing it from overwhelming the soup’s delicate balance.
